About The Position

The Child Development Lab (CDL) within the Sanford School at ASU-Tempe is seeking a highly qualified, flexible, on-call Instructional Specialist, PRN, to join our team. As a PRN employee, this is an as-needed, non-benefits eligible position with no guaranteed minimum hours. The CDL operates Monday through Friday from 7:00am-5:30pm. Potential shifts would include hours like 7:00am-3:00pm, 9:30-5:30pm, or any other variation within our hours of operation. While some absences are planned with advanced notice, many absences are unplanned and require on-call availability. Please note that this position is 100% onsite. Under the direction of the Child Development Manager, this role supports the implementation of developmentally appropriate early childhood education curriculum and activities. In addition, the position plays a key role in maintaining high standards of care by providing classroom support in preschool settings as needed during peak periods, staff absences, and staffing shortages. The role is based in a full-day childcare and preschool environment serving children ages two through five.
